Journal ArticleDOI

Identifying effective design features of commercial sports bras

TL;DR: The study concluded that the most effective bras had the following features: compression type, short vest style, highneckline, slings, cross back, bound neckline, no centre gore, no wire, no cradle, no pad and a non-adjustable wide strap.
